INFO

Jed the Humanoid, originally released in September of 2001, was inspired by the song of the same name by the band Grandaddy. It was my first (and at the time of this writing, my only) attempt at making a futuristic font. The caps and lowercase are the same. More punctuation glyphs have been added since its original release. This is a DEMO version of the font. It includes only uppercase and lowercase letters.
